Top 3 Small Dog Costume Ideas

There are a wide variety of small dog costumes on the market, with everything from hot dogs to designer clothing, but here are three of the funniest and most popular ideas.

Remember that when choosing a costume for your pooch, you need to keep their size in mind. You don’t want your dog to be uncomfortable in their costume when you’re out trick or treating. Not every costume for dogs will fit your dog, so keep that in mind while choosing a costume.

The Cutest Hot Dog In Town

A regular favorite among many small dog breeds in the hot dog costume. This costume includes two soft buns that wrap around your dog, with options for both plain and seeded, with ketchup or mustard embroidery. Some designs even have Velcro under their belly for convenience, while others wrap Velcro around the front, especially fitted for shorter dogs. Think of how adorable and funny your dog will be walking around town as a hot dog!

Come Here, Pumpkin!

A classic Halloween costume is of course, a pumpkin. What better costume for the family dog than a big plush pumpkin. This costume is best for medium-sized dogs, and it’s super comfortable because they’re walking around in a big pumpkin pillow. And don’t forget, the costume wouldn’t be complete without your dog’s little orange cap with a green stem on top!

Adorable on Halloween, You Will Be

He may not be able to talk like Yoda, but your little dog can certainly look like Yoda this Halloween. This costume is complete with a green, big eared headpiece and a jumpsuit that looks just like Yoda’s outfit in the movie. If you and your furry friend love Star Wars, this costume will stir up some excitement as he is transformed into the legendary Jedi Master!

For those of our furry friends who have not worn a costume before, here are a few tips-

– Don’t leave it until the last minute – order a Halloween costume for your dog a couple of weeks before;

– Choose one that looks like it will be safe, comfortable and not restrict movement;

– Make sure you choose the correct size. The Dog Pumpkin Costume fits with velcro which means it can be adjusted to suit. Some online dog boutiques offer a free service to check and measure all dog clothing for you. If in doubt over the size – you are best going for slightly larger to ensure there is no restriction of movement. Also dog clothing should not be skin tight – there must always be room to allow their body to breathe and avoid overheating.

– Check there is nothing on the costume that can harm your dog.

– When the costume arrives, let your dog sniff it, then lay it over him for a minute, praise him and then give him a treat. Do this every day, leaving the costume on for longer each time. Eventually put the costume on your dog – but loosely and repeat as above by leaving it on him for a few minutes and then praise him, and I’ve him a treat – extending the time each day.

You will be able to tell from your dog’s response if he is happy with the costume. If you try the above and your dog gets nervous or anxious – then he is one of the dogs that do not like dressing up, and it would be unfair to continue. Maybe try different materials or styles, however if he continues to look anxious, then it is best to leave dressing your dog up.

When wearing a dog costume it is important to ensure that you do not leave your pet unattended at any time.
